Seeking Interim Relief in DRT Proceedings: Strategies and Considerations
When navigating the intricacies of Debt Recovery Tribunal (DRT) proceedings, obtaining interim relief can prove to be a valuable strategic maneuver. This type of relief, often granted by the tribunal prior to the final resolution of a case, may encompass measures such as restraining a party from alienating assets, directing the release of funds, or temporarily enforcing payment schedules. Strategically securing interim relief hinges on a meticulous understanding of the relevant laws, procedural requirements, and the specific facts of the case.
- Applicants should carefully draft their applications for interim relief, providing clear and compelling reasons supported by relevant evidence.
- Demonstrating the urgency of the situation and the potential damage that could result from inaction is crucial.
- Legal counsel should be consulted to guarantee that all procedures are meticulously followed, and to formulate a persuasive legal position.
Furthermore, it is often productive to engage in out-of-court negotiations with the opposing party. Such discussions may result in a acceptable resolution, thus circumventing the need for a formal hearing on interim relief.
Grasping the Grounds for DRT Interim Orders
DRT interim orders are issued by the Debt Recovery Tribunals under specific grounds outlined in the law. These orders function as short-term remedies, designed to resolve potential harm or breaches during current debt recovery proceedings. The bases for implementing such orders are rigorously scrutinized to ensure fairness and legal propriety. Instances of valid grounds for DRT interim orders include situations where there is a threat of assetmovement, hiding of evidence, or infringement of a court order.

Effect of DRT Interim Relief on Parties Involved
DRT interim relief can materially impact the parties involved in a dispute. For the petitioner, it can provide crucial support by preserving their interests while the case is pending. Conversely, for the respondent, interim relief can create difficulties by limiting their ability to operate business or defend the allegations. The extent of these consequences will depend on the specifics of each case, including the nature of the dispute and the provisions of the interim relief granted.
